South Australia's biggest sculpture exhibition is back on Wednesday the 18th of January 2023. For twelve days, you have the opportunity to not only view art within the spectacular Brighton setting but also purchase any that fancies you. All sculptures will be available for sale during the exhibition. Funds raised will go back into the Brighton Surf Life Saving Club.

As usual, Brighton Jetty Sculptures will showcase both outdoor and indoor sculptures. The outdoor installations can be found along the Esplanade between Dunluce Avenue and Old Beach Road. You can view them at any time. As for the indoor sculptures, they will be on display at Bindarra Reserve from 8am to 8pm. Entry is free.
